From...

@automobilemag: How fast is the 707-hp #Dodge Challenger #Hellcat? Try 11.2 sec at 125 mph -- on street tires! http://t.co/fS23QreIIa http://t.co/c0WdVKnKmS

"We already knew the 2015 Dodge Challenger Hellcat packed a 707-hp punch from its supercharged 6.2-liter V-8 engine, but now we know just how quickly the muscle car will hustle down a quarter-mile track. According to Dodge's own testing, the Hellcat runs the quarter mile in 11.2 seconds at 125 mph.

When fitted with drag radials instead of its standard Pirelli P Zero street tires, the Hellcat managed a 10.8-second run at 126 mph.
"It wasn't long ago that a 10-second car, was a full-on race car," Dodge and SRT president Tim Kuniskis said in a statement. "Not only can Challenger run 10s on the drag strip, but you can also fit your family and drive cross country."
